About 03 Numbers
Numerous organizations adopt 03 numbers instead of the more costly 08 numbers. For instance, numerous public sector bodies have transitioned from 0845 numbers to 0345. The cost of calls is no more than calls to geographic numbers (01 or 02). Call charges depend on the time of the day, and most providers offer call packages that allow calls free of charge during certain times of the day. Mobile call costs vary depending on the selected calling plan. Generally, these calls are included in free call packages.
